Moving Your Home in Belmont, Ohio
Deciding to move your home, whether across town or across the country, is a significant undertaking. The first big question is often whether to tackle it yourself or hire professional moving services. While a DIY move might seem like a cost-saving measure, it comes with its own set of challenges and potential pitfalls. For many in Belmont, Ohio, the decision often boils down to time, physical capacity, and the sheer volume of belongings to manage. Understanding the trade-offs involved is crucial for a smoother transition.
The allure of a DIY move is understandable. You have complete control over the packing, loading, and unloading. However, it requires significant physical exertion, especially for larger furniture and numerous boxes. You’ll need to rent a truck, secure packing supplies, and likely enlist friends or family for help, which can sometimes strain relationships. If something goes wrong – a damaged item, an injury, or a logistical hiccup – the responsibility and cost fall squarely on your shoulders. This often involves unforeseen expenses like extra trips, replacement costs for damaged goods, or even lost time from work if you’re juggling moving and your job.
On the other hand, engaging professional moving services offers a structured and often more efficient approach. This category encompasses a range of assistance, from full-service residential moving to specialized long-distance transportation. For local moves within Belmont, this might involve a team arriving with a truck, carefully packing your belongings, loading them efficiently, and then transporting them to your new residence. For cross-country moves, the process is more involved, often requiring specialized equipment for longer hauls and meticulous planning to ensure your possessions arrive safely and on schedule.
The benefits of professional movers extend beyond just physical labor. Reputable providers have the experience to pack fragile items securely, utilize their trucks effectively to maximize space and minimize damage, and navigate the logistics of traffic and route planning. They understand how to properly lift and carry heavy objects, reducing the risk of personal injury. Furthermore, many companies offer valuation coverage for your belongings, providing a level of financial protection that a DIY move simply cannot match. Storage units are also a common offering, providing a secure temporary or long-term solution for items you may not need immediate access to at your new home, or if there’s a gap between moving out and moving in.
What separates a good local provider for your moving needs? It starts with clear communication. They should be able to explain their services, pricing structure, and what to expect on moving day. A reliable provider will be transparent about potential additional costs, such as for difficult-to-access homes or excessive packing supplies. When choosing someone to handle your move, consider their experience with the types of items you own – do they have experience moving pianos, large art pieces, or specialized equipment? Look for providers who demonstrate a commitment to careful handling and proper packing techniques.
